What happened?

When I added this feed https://rss.libsyn.com/shows/108587/destinations/590891.xml the podcast was added to audiobookshelf, but it does not show up in my library. If I try to add it again it says "Podcast already exists". When I search for it it also shows as added. A folder for the podcast is also added.

Image Image Image

What did you expect to happen?

I expect the podcast to show up in my library.

Steps to reproduce the issue

  1. Add new podcast using this feed: https://rss.libsyn.com/shows/108587/destinations/590891.xml
  2. See that it is not in the library
  3. Try to add it again
  4. See that you get an error message saying "Podcast already exists"

Audiobookshelf version

2.33.1

How are you running audiobookshelf?

Docker

What OS is your Audiobookshelf server hosted from?

Linux

If the issue is being seen in the UI, what browsers are you seeing the problem on?

Chrome

Logs

2026-04-09 11:27:05.562

INFO

[CoverManager] Downloaded libraryItem cover "/podcasts/Game Maker's Notebook/cover.jpg" from url "https://static.libsyn.com/p/assets/0/7/b/8/07b82da6bb2817da27a2322813b393ee/gmn-icon-1400-20240513-2qwv47wecw.jpg"

2026-04-09 11:27:05.867

INFO

[CronManager] Added podcast "Game Maker's Notebook" to auto dl episode cron "0 * * * *"

2026-04-09 11:27:56.521

ERROR

[PodcastController] Podcast already exists at path "/podcasts/Game Maker's Notebook"

Additional Notes

Also tested in Chrome browser and happens there.
